Output 6eefec0147cdc7a695ba3ee65986f159f72545e4aa7a1a4480437956e1745e88:139

value
89201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bd2c7d89754900868f8f0961f7694dbe926fc04 OP_EQUAL
address
3BX8jNAtzLLXPCsArXmVvJ6W5G8qpT7Qgz
transaction
6eefec0147cdc7a695ba3ee65986f159f72545e4aa7a1a4480437956e1745e88
confirmations
156305
spent
true